Broncos QB Joe Flacco recalls his draft-day experience

The 2019 NFL draft will begin Thursday, and the lives of top college football prospects will be changed forever.

In 2008, quarterback Joe Flacco entered the draft after a record-setting career at Delaware. He described his draft-day experience to media members in Denver this week.

“I remember not wanting any cameras in my house, but eventually folding and having somebody come to my house,” Flacco said April 16. “I didn’t know when I was going to be picked. I could’ve been a third-round pick and I could’ve been a first-round pick. Obviously, it was a pretty good day for me.

“It’s an exciting time. To become an NFL player, or at least have a chance to be an NFL player, it’s a pretty special moment. You can’t take for granted how much hard work it takes to get to this league and get to where these guys are about to get to. It’ll be a lot of fun for guys, I think.”

Flacco was selected by Baltimore with the 18th overall pick in 2008, and he went on to spend the first 11 years of his career with the Ravens. He went on to help Baltimore win Super Bowl XLVII after the 2012 season.
